> > > > Current check of phydev with IS_ERR(phydev) may make not much sense
> > > > because of_phy_connect() returns NULL on failure instead of error value.
> > > > 
> > > > Still for checking result of phy_connect() IS_ERR() makes perfect sense.
> > > > 
> > > > So let's use combined check IS_ERR_OR_NULL() that covers both cases.

> > > > @@ -837,9 +837,12 @@ static int stmmac_init_phy(struct net_device *dev)
> > > >                                      interface);
> > > >         }
> > > > 
> > > > -       if (IS_ERR(phydev)) {
> > > > +       if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(phydev)) {
> > > >                 pr_err("%s: Could not attach to PHY\n", dev->name);
> > > > -               return PTR_ERR(phydev);
> > > > +               if (!phydev)
> > > > +                       return -ENODEV;
> > > > +               else
> > > > +                       return PTR_ERR(phydev);
> > > 
> > >      Don't need *else* after *return* and scripts/checkpatch.pl should 
> > > have
> > > complained about that.
